Cameron University vs. Oklahoma State University-Main Campus (Oklahoma State)

Compare two schools with tuition, admission, test scores, and more academic characteristics.

  • Both Cameron University and Oklahoma State University-Main Campus (Oklahoma State) are public.
  • Both schools are located in Oklahoma.
  • Oklahoma State has more expensive tuition of $25,754 than Cameron University ($16,320).
  • Oklahoma State is larger with 25,372 students than Cameron University (3,418 students).
